Study in Hungary
Hungary is a Central European country known for its rich history, cultural heritage, and affordable higher education. It shares borders with Austria, Slovakia, Romania, Serbia, Croatia, and Slovenia. The country has a population of about 9.6 million people, with Budapest as its capital and largest city. Other major cities include Debrecen, Szeged, and Pécs. The official language is Hungarian, and the currency is the Hungarian Forint (HUF). Hungary operates as a parliamentary republic. Hungary is widely recognized for offering quality education at affordable costs, particularly in fields like medicine, engineering, and business. The country has a long tradition of higher education with internationally recognized universities. Many programs are available in English, making Hungary an attractive destination for international students seeking a combination of academic excellence and cultural experience.
